Operated by Thomson Reuters, Super Lawyers is a rating program that recognizes the work of outstanding attorneys in over 70 practice areas. Each year, candidates for the Super Lawyer distinction are nominated by attorney peers and the candidate pool is finalized after research by the Super Lawyers staff. To maintain the integrity of the nomination process, Super Lawyers prohibits attorneys from campaigning for the award and tracks where nominations come from. 

After the candidate pool is established, each nominee is evaluated in terms of peer recognition and professional achievement. Super Lawyers considers the nominees’ verdict history, experience, scholarly work, pro bono activities, honors and awards, and other outstanding achievements when making its selections for the annual awards. The final steps in the selection process include peer evaluations and a vetting procedure that ensures each prospective award winner is in good standing and has never faced disciplinary or criminal proceedings. 

When the annual Super Lawyers list is finalized, it is published in state and regional issues of Super Lawyers magazine as well as other magazines and newspapers. No more than 5 percent of all lawyers in each state receive the annual award. To find a listing of previous Super Lawyers, visit www.superlawyers.com.
